1-1 of 1
Authors: Qin Yang
Sort by
Journal Article
Jie Zhang and others
Carcinogenesis, Volume 46, Issue 2, February 2025, bgaf005, https://doi.org/10.1093/carcin/bgaf005
Published: 13 February 2025